Summary

Wale, Megan Thee Stallion's '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ion)' came out on October 11, 2019.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ion) is considered explicit and may contain foul language. This song is about 3 minutes and 29 seconds, which is about the average length of a typical song. This song is part of Wow... That's Crazy by Wale. The song's track number on the album is #15 out of 15 tracks. Based on our data, United States was the country where this track was produced or recorded. Based on our statistics,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ion)'s popularity is average in popularity right now. Although the overall vibe is very danceable, it does project more negative sounds.

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ion) BPM

Since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ion) by Wale, Megan Thee Stallion has a tempo of 134 beats per a minute, the tempo markings of this song would be Allegro (fast, quick, and bright). With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ion) being at 134 BPM, the half-time would be 67 BPM with a double-time of 268 BPM.In addition, we consider the tempo speed to be pretty fast for this song. This makes this song perfect for activities such as, walking.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

Poledancer (feat. Megan Thee Stallion) Key

The music key of this track is D♭ Major.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 3B. So, the perfect camelot match for 3B would be either 3B or 4A. While, 4B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 12B and a high energy boost can either be 5B or 10B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 3A or 2B will give you a low energy drop, 6B would be a moderate one, and 1B or 8B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 12A allows you to change the mood.
